Unexplained Mud Tubes or Damaged Wood
You might notice thin, pencil-sized mud tunnels on your foundation, walls, or wooden structures around your property. Sometimes the signs are even more subtle, like discovering wood that sounds hollow when tapped or shows blistering and unexplained darkening. These are classic signs of subterranean termite activity, and our humid climate is highly conducive to their constant growth.
These mud tubes act as protected highways between their underground colonies and your home's vulnerable wood. Termites can cause extensive, often hidden, structural damage that can cost thousands of dollars to repair if left unchecked. Without proactive termite prevention or early intervention, your home's integrity can be severely compromised over time.

Small Droppings or Gnaw Marks
You find tiny, dark pellet-like droppings in cabinets, drawers, or hidden away behind your kitchen appliances. You might also notice small chew marks on food packaging, wooden baseboards, or even electrical wires in your attic or garage. These are definitive signs of rodent activity, as mice and rats are constantly seeking food, water, and shelter.
Rodents contaminate food and surfaces, can spread diseases, and their gnawing can cause significant damage to property, including dangerous electrical fires. Early detection and prevention are crucial to avoid an entrenched rodent problem that becomes much harder to eliminate. Stopping them at the perimeter is always easier than trying to remove them once they have nested inside.

Gaps and Cracks in Your Home's Exterior
Over time, homes naturally settle, building materials contract and expand with temperature changes, and general wear and tear create small openings. You will often find these vulnerabilities around windows, doors, utility penetrations, and along the base of the foundation. The fluctuating humidity and temperature extremes in Herty can accelerate the degradation of sealants and materials, creating even more pathways for pests.
A thorough inspection is required to identify these hidden entry points before pests can exploit them. The solution involves professional sealing, caulking, and minor repairs to create a robust, physical barrier against invaders. Closing these gaps is a foundational step in any effective pest prevention strategy.
Excess Moisture Around the Foundation
Poor drainage, clogged gutters, leaky outdoor faucets, or even dense landscaping can lead to water pooling directly near your home's foundation. This creates damp soil and wet surfaces that act as a massive attractant for a variety of insects and rodents. Our abundant rainfall and high humidity levels mean that moisture issues are particularly prevalent and persistent in this area.
Moisture-seeking pests like termites, cockroaches, and ants thrive in these exact conditions and will eventually push their way inside. Addressing drainage issues, repairing leaks, and ensuring proper ventilation and grading around the foundation helps keep the perimeter dry. Landscaping Too Close to the House
Shrubs, trees, and other vegetation directly touching the side of your home or overhanging the roof create convenient physical bridges for pests. These branches allow insects and rodents to access your house effortlessly, completely bypassing your ground-level defenses. Many properties have mature, extensive landscaping that inadvertently provides ideal harborage and pathways for pests migrating from nearby wooded areas.
Strategic trimming of vegetation and maintaining a clear, dry perimeter around the foundation removes these hidden highways.
